Search a number
-
+
15686970660 = 223251737349397
BaseRepresentation
bin11101001110000010…
…00010110100100100
31111111020210200021100
432213001002310210
5224111331030120
611112334120100
71063511023224
oct164701026444
944436720240
1015686970660
11671a982269
123059650030
13162cc75a7a
14a8b56a084
1561c2b1490
hex3a7042d24

15686970660 has 288 divisors, whose sum is σ = 52023535200. Its totient is φ = 3810115584.

The previous prime is 15686970647. The next prime is 15686970683. The reversal of 15686970660 is 6607968651.

15686970660 is a `hidden beast` number, since 1 + 568 + 6 + 9 + 70 + 6 + 6 + 0 = 666.

It can be written as a sum of positive squares in 16 ways, for example, as 225540324 + 15461430336 = 15018^2 + 124344^2 .

It is a junction number, because it is equal to n+sod(n) for n = 15686970597 and 15686970606.

It is an unprimeable number.

It is a polite number, since it can be written in 95 ways as a sum of consecutive naturals, for example, 39513582 + ... + 39513978.

It is an arithmetic number, because the mean of its divisors is an integer number (180637275).

Almost surely, 215686970660 is an apocalyptic number.

15686970660 is a gapful number since it is divisible by the number (10) formed by its first and last digit.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 15686970660,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(26011767600).

15686970660 is an abundant number, since it is smaller than the sum of its proper divisors (36336564540).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

15686970660 is a wasteful number, since it uses less digits than its factorization.

15686970660 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 815 (or 810 counting only the distinct ones).

The product of its (nonzero) digits is 3265920, while the sum is 54.

It can be divided in two parts, 156869 and 70660, that added together give a square (227529 = 4772).

The spelling of 15686970660 in words is "fifteen billion, six hundred eighty-six million, nine hundred seventy thousand, six hundred sixty".